Embodiment 1

[0030] A nutritional meal replacement powder with high dietary fiber, and its components are as follows by weight:

[0031] Flaxseed flour 30, brown rice 18, black rice 18, buckwheat 5, red bean 20, resistant dextrin 3, red dates 3, almond 1

[0032] After the grains and beans are dried and matured by hot air or puffed and matured respectively, they are crushed to 80-100 mesh at low temperature for use;

[0033] After drying the flaxseed powder, dietary fiber powder, grain powder, soybean powder, and fruit and vegetable powder separately, they are mixed in proportions

[0034] Evenly

[0035] Quantitative packaging, namely nutritional meal replacement powder.

Embodiment 2

[0037] A nutritional meal replacement powder with high dietary fiber, and its components are as follows by weight:

[0038] Flaxseed meal 18, brown rice 25, red rice 5, barley 8, buckwheat 15, soybean 17, konjac flour 4, oat fiber 2, pineapple 5, lemon 1

[0039] After the grains and beans are dried and matured by hot air or puffed and matured respectively, they are crushed to 80-100 mesh at low temperature for use;

[0040] After drying the flaxseed powder, dietary fiber powder, grain powder, soybean powder, and fruit and vegetable powder separately, they are mixed in proportions

[0041] Evenly

[0042] Quantitative packaging, namely nutritional meal replacement powder.

Embodiment 3

[0044] A nutritional meal replacement powder with high dietary fiber, and its components are as follows by weight:

[0045] Flaxseed meal 8, black rice 17, rice 20, oats 10, mung bean 35 (should be changed to 35, modified according to opinions), resistant dextrin 6, strawberry 1, tomato 1, cabbage 0.89, vitamin D 0.01, pyrophosphate Iron 0.1, protein powder 1

[0046] After the grains and beans are dried and matured by hot air or puffed and matured respectively, they are crushed to 80-100 mesh at low temperature for use;

[0047] After drying the flaxseed powder, dietary fiber powder, grain powder, soybean powder, fruits and vegetables, vitamin powder and protein powder respectively,

[0048] Example for compounding and mixing evenly;

[0049] Quantitative packaging, namely nutritional meal replacement powder.

Abstract

The invention discloses high-dietary-fiber nutritional meal replacement powder and a processing method thereof, relates to a meal replacement powder food, and particularly relates to the high-dietary-fiber nutritional meal replacement powder which contains polyunsaturated fatty acids, is rich in nutrition, diversified in mouthfeel, and easy to process, store and eat as well as a processing method thereof. The high-dietary-fiber nutritional meal replacement powder comprises the following raw materials in parts by weight: 3-30 parts of flaxseed powder, 20-60 parts of cereal powder, 10-35 parts of soybean powder, 3-16 parts of dietary fiber powder and 1-15 parts of fruit and vegetable powder. The processing method of the high-dietary-fiber nutritional meal replacement powder comprises the following steps: carrying out hot air drying curing or expansion curing on cereals and soybeans respectively, and crushing at a low temperature to 80-100 meshes for later use; drying flaxseed powder, dietary fiber powder, cereal powder, soybean powder and fruit and vegetable powder, blending in proportion, and mixing evenly; and packaging quantitatively so as to obtain the nutritional meal replacement powder.

Technical field [0001] The invention relates to a meal replacement powder food, in particular to a high dietary fiber nutritional meal replacement powder containing golden flax seeds and a processing method thereof. Background technique [0002] With the improvement of living standards and changes in dietary structure, people increasingly pursue delicious enjoyment, and gradually ignore the rationality of dietary nutrition structure. For example, the intake of animal food increases while the intake of dietary fiber decreases, the intake of fat increases, and the intake of essential fatty acids.
